China's leader-in-waiting appears

Chinese leader-in-waiting Xi Jinping reappeared in public today following a two-week absence that had sparked rumours about his health and raised questions about the stability of the country’s succession process.

State media said Xi toured exhibits at China Agricultural University in Beijing commemorating National Science Popularisation Day, but offered no explanation as to why he had dropped from sight.
